What Is Modrinth?
Modrinth is an open-source platform designed for hosting Minecraft mods, plugins, resource packs, and modpacks. It competes with older platforms like CurseForge, offering a more developer-focused, transparent, and flexible ecosystem. Unlike many closed systems, Modrinth emphasizes community moderation and open APIs.
Its key features include:
- Open-source infrastructure
- Active moderation teams
- Creator verification systems
- Built-in malware scanning
- Direct mod loader compatibility (Fabric, Forge, Quilt, etc.)
The site has gained popularity because it positions itself as transparent and developer-friendly, but safety ultimately depends on how it manages risk and how users behave.
Is Modrinth Safe to Download From?
In general, yes—Modrinth is considered safe, especially when compared to random file-sharing websites. The platform implements several security layers that significantly reduce the likelihood of malware infections.
1. Automated Malware Scanning
Modrinth uses automated systems to scan uploaded files for known malware signatures. This helps prevent common threats, including:
- Trojan injectors disguised as mods
- Backdoor scripts
- Malicious Java code
- Crypto miners embedded in mod files
While no scanner can catch every zero-day threat, automated scanning drastically reduces common risks.
2. Human Moderation
The platform maintains a moderation team that reviews reported files. If suspicious activity is flagged, moderators can remove content quickly. Community reporting also plays a major role in identifying potential security threats.
3. Open-Source Transparency
Because Modrinth is open-source, its infrastructure and code can be audited by developers. This transparency adds credibility and reduces the chances of hidden malicious behavior within the platform itself.

Potential Risks to Consider
Even though Modrinth itself is structured to be secure, some risks still exist. Understanding these helps users make informed decisions.
User-Generated Content Always Carries Some Risk
Mods are created by independent developers. Although scanning tools exist, new forms of malicious code occasionally slip through automated systems. This is true for every mod platform.
Impersonation
Occasionally, bad actors may attempt to impersonate well-known developers. This is rare but possible. Verifying creator profiles and checking project history can help mitigate this risk.
Outdated Mods
Older mods may not be compatible with newer Minecraft versions. While not necessarily malicious, outdated files can cause crashes or vulnerabilities in modded environments.
Users should avoid downloading old, unmaintained files unless they fully understand the risks.
Best Practices for Staying Safe on Modrinth
Even on a secure platform, smart habits are essential. The following steps dramatically improve safety:
✅ Download Only From Official Project Pages
Never download reuploaded files from secondary sources claiming to “mirror” Modrinth content.
✅ Check Developer Profiles
Look for:
- Consistent upload history
- Clear documentation
- Active issue tracking
- Community engagement
✅ Read Comments and Reviews
If other users report crashes, bugs, or suspicious behavior, take those warnings seriously.
✅ Keep Antivirus Software Enabled
Even if a mod platform scans files, local antivirus software provides an additional security layer.
✅ Use Official Mod Loaders
Install mods through reputable launchers or loaders such as Fabric or Forge rather than manually modifying game files without knowledge.

Signs a Mod Might Be Unsafe
While Modrinth is proactive, users should still stay alert. Warning signs include:
- Brand-new accounts with no prior uploads
- No description or documentation
- Disabled comments
- External download links instead of direct Modrinth hosting
- Unusual file sizes for simple mods
If any of these appear, caution is advised.
What Happens If Something Goes Wrong?
If a user suspects a malicious mod:
- Disconnect from the internet.
- Run a full antivirus scan.
- Remove suspicious files immediately.
- Report the mod through Modrinth’s reporting system.
Because of its active moderation structure, reported content is typically addressed promptly.
